Best Decks For The Evolutions Mayhem Event In Clash Royale
In Clash Royale, a special event called “Evolution’s Chaos” is happening between March 10th and March 17th. During this period, you can construct a deck consisting of eight cards, with four evolution cards and four standard ones. With approximately 30 evolved cards available in the game, such as ground troops like Barbarians and the newly introduced Evolved Hunter, you’ll have numerous choices to select from.
As a gamer, when I triumph in a match, I’ll net myself some seasonal tokens. These tokens can be swapped for Magic Items, Evolution Shards, Card Upgrades, Coins, and other goodies. On top of the regular gameplay, there’s an exciting event called the Evolutions Mayhem Challenge happening from March 14 to March 17. If I participate, I might just score a unique banner as a reward!

Deck 1
Cards | Cost |
---|---|
Evo Barbarians | Five Elixir |
Evo Wizard | Five Elixir |
Evo Valkyrie | Four Elixir |
Evo Cannon | Three Elixir |
Berserker | Two Elixir |
Night Witch | Four Elixir |
Elixir Golem | Three Elixir |
Executioner | Five Elixir |
In this setup, the focus lies primarily on infantry on the ground. Therefore, your tactical approach plays a crucial role. Consider combining Evo Barbarians with an attacking unit at range, such as Executioner or Evo Wizard, for additional assistance. Night Witch is exceptionally effective at annihilating adversaries along with her swarm of Bats. Lastly, Elixir Golem serves admirably as a robust tank against powerful units and buildings; it splits into smaller troops when vanquished.
Berserker is effective against large groups and medium-sized forces, whereas Valkyrie can manage virtually any situation. To strike enemies before they get close to your towers, simply deploy an Evo Cannon on your battlefield side.
Deck 2

Cards | Cost |
---|---|
Evo Barbarians | Five Elixir |
Evo Mega Knight | Seven Elixir |
Evo Firecracker | Three Elixir |
Evo Wizard | Five Elixir |
Skeleton Army | Three Elixir |
Witch | Five Elixir |
Goblin Barrel | Three Elixir |
Princess | Three Elixir |
In a simplified manner, if you’re taking the initial action, start by deploying a tank along with a long-range backup card from your available deck. You might consider using the Evo Mega Knight and Firecracker. The Mega Knight comes at a higher cost, but the Firecracker is easier to cycle through your cards.
To begin with, aim at knocking down one of your adversary’s towers to make it simpler for you to move over to their side quickly. Utilize Goblin Barrel, Evo Barbarians, Evo Wizard, and Skeletons to manage the duelists and focus on the towers. Princess and Witch can also be effective as support cards in this strategy. Deck 3

Cards | Cost |
---|---|
Evo Giant Snowball | Two Elixir |
Evo Skeletons | One Elixir |
Evo Goblin Barrel | Three Elixir |
Evo Tesla | Four Elixir |
Little Prince | Three Elixir |
Witch | Five Elixir |
Inferno Dragon | Four Elixir |
Princess | Three Elixir |
This deck features economical cards that develop rapidly. Begin by deploying The Little Prince, followed by the Inferno Dragon, Witch, and Evo Skeletons for reinforcements. If an adversary moves swiftly or heavily towards your territory, retaliate using the Evo Giant Snowball to either immobilize or force them back.
As a gamer, I’m deploying Princess to take care of my opponents. Continuously, I’m launching the Evo Goblin Barrel towards their towers for some damage. And to protect my own territory, I’ve strategically positioned an Evo Tesla in the heart of my side.
